PENANG
Penang State consists of an island and a small mainland section (Butterworth). It has been a crossroad since old times, an obligatory port of call for traders from Arabia, India, China, etc. Thus it has a diverse population. It is famous for its cuisine and recently has become a high tech industry location. Tourism is also important
